Signature: "Clinton Scollard.", in black ink, 2x3¾. Clinton
Scollard (1860-1932) was an American poet, most popular in the late 1800's
and early 1900's. Friends with fellow poets Bliss Carman and Frank Dempster
Sherman, Scollard was noted for being a more minor poet, but the works he did
present were always well composed. He published several works of verse during
his writing career, including Pictures in Song (1884), On Sunny
Shores (1893), Poems (1914), and Ballads, Patriotic and
Romantic (1916). He was married to literary scholar Jessie Belle
Rittenhouse, and remained with her until his death in 1932. Lightly toned.
